How they compare
Canada currently reports 1.2 LCU per international $ against 1.14 LCU per international $ in Nauru, a difference of 0.06 LCU per international $.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 12 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Canada ahead.
Canada ranks 143rd and Nauru ranks 145th of 201 countries.
Canada has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Canada | Nauru |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 1.3 LCU per international $ | 1.22 LCU per international $ | 0.0785 LCU per international $ | Canada |
| 2020s | 1.27 LCU per international $ | 1.16 LCU per international $ | 0.1067 LCU per international $ | Canada |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
